Methods to Select the Right Forex Broker for Your Trading Needs
The overseas exchange (Forex) market gives lucrative opportunities for traders around the globe. Nonetheless, in an effort to navigate the world of Forex successfully, one of the vital decisions you’ll need to make is deciding on the precise Forex broker. A broker acts because the intermediary between you and the market, executing your trades, providing access to trading platforms, and offering valuable tools and resources to enhance your trading strategy. Choosing the fallacious broker can lead to poor execution, hidden fees, and even fraud, which is why it’s critical to select one that fits your distinctive trading needs.
1. Regulation and Licensing
The first and most important factor to consider when choosing a Forex broker is regulation. A regulated broker is topic to the rules and oversight of a monetary authority, which helps ensure that the broker operates fairly and transparently. Widespread regulatory our bodies embody:
- Monetary Conduct Authority (FCA) in the UK
-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) in the US
-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C)
-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C)
Make sure the broker you are considering is licensed by a reputable authority in their region. This will offer you confidence that the broker follows strict monetary rules and has your interests in mind. If a broker is not regulated, this is usually a red flag and increase the risks associated with your trading.
2. Trading Platform and Tools
A broker’s trading platform is the gateway to the Forex market. Most brokers provide their own proprietary platforms, but many also provide access to third-party platforms like MetaTrader four (MT4) or MetaTrader 5 (MT5). When selecting a broker, consider the following aspects of their platform:
- Ease of Use: The platform ought to be consumer-friendly, intuitive, and customizable. It should can help you quickly execute trades and monitor your account.
- Advanced Charting and Analysis Tools: If you're a technical trader, the broker’s platform ought to supply advanced charting tools, real-time value data, and indicators to help you analyze the market.
- Mobile Access: In in the present day’s fast-paced trading environment, having a mobile-friendly platform is essential. Look for brokers that supply strong mobile trading apps that mirror the functionality of their desktop platforms.
Additionally, check if the broker provides instructional resources, corresponding to webinars, articles, and tutorials, that will help you improve your trading skills.
3. Spreads and Commission Fees
Forex brokers make cash through spreads, which are the differences between the buying and selling value of a currency pair. Some brokers additionally charge fee charges on trades. It’s essential to understand the cost structure to avoid paying extreme fees that eat into your profits.
- Fixed Spreads: A fixed spread stays the identical regardless of market conditions. This type of spread presents consistency and predictability however could also be slightly wider than variable spreads.
- Variable Spreads: These spreads fluctuate with market conditions. While they will sometimes be narrower during times of low volatility, they may widen during instances of market uncertainty or high volatility.
Make certain to check the spreads of different brokers, especially for the currency pairs you plan to trade frequently. Also, understand whether any additional hidden charges or commissions apply, as these can impact your general trading costs.
4. Leverage and Margin
Leverage allows you to control bigger positions with a smaller quantity of capital, amplifying both your potential profits and losses. Completely different brokers provide various levels of leverage, with some providing as a lot as 500:1. Nonetheless, higher leverage will increase risk, so it’s essential to decide on a broker that aligns with your risk tolerance and trading strategy.
- Margin Requirements: Check the broker’s margin requirements for different currency pairs and be certain that they align with your preferred position sizes. The broker ought to provide clear information about how much margin is required to take care of a trade.
While high leverage can provide bigger profits, it may lead to significant losses, so use it cautiously and only you probably have enough experience.
5. Customer Assist and Reputation
When trading within the risky world of Forex, having access to reliable customer help is vital. Look for brokers that supply 24/7 customer support, preferably through a number of channels such as phone, electronic mail, and live chat. A responsive and knowledgeable help team might help resolve points quickly and guarantee a smooth trading experience.
Additionally, research the repute of the broker. Look for reviews from other traders, check on-line forums, and verify if there are any complaints or regulatory actions against the broker. A reputable broker should have positive feedback from shoppers and a clear business record.
6. Account Types and Minimal Deposit
Finally, consider the types of accounts the broker offers. Many brokers provide a range of account options, equivalent to:
- Standard Accounts: Suitable for most retail traders with average trade sizes.
- ECN Accounts: Supply direct market access with tighter spreads, but they typically require a higher minimal deposit.
- Mini and Micro Accounts: Can help you trade with smaller lot sizes and lower minimal deposits, making them superb for newbie traders.
Make sure that the broker’s account types meet your needs, whether or not you are just starting or have more experience. Also, confirm the broker’s minimal deposit requirements to make sure it fits within your budget.
Conclusion
Choosing the proper Forex broker is a crucial step in your trading journey. Take the time to evaluate key factors comparable to regulation, platform functionality, spreads, leverage, buyer assist, and account types. By deciding on a broker that aligns with your trading style and goals, you can reduce risks and improve your chances of success within the Forex market. Always keep in mind to do your due diligence, and don’t hesitate to test out completely different brokers through demo accounts earlier than committing real capital.
